In short, your body has feedback loops and specialized cells that sense levels of different hormones and enzymes in the blood, when these get out of balance your body tries to correct it
estrogen rebound(for us) normally happens after using a compound letrozole (that reduces estrogen levels by 99%), after the drug leaves the body the feedback loop realizes that there is very little estrogen left so it starts producing a ton of estrogen to bring the body back to homeostasis(balance) and in the process causes a huge flux of estrogen called estrogen rebound
